 Brief History of Kelp Industries

The story of Kelp Industries is one of the unique success based on the utilization of a fully renewable resource and the knowledge, creativity and initiative of King Islanders
King Island is located in Bass Strait midway between Melbourne and the North West coast of mainland Tasmania. The island is surrounded by reefs which support the growth of Durvillace Potatorum, known locally as Bull Kelp Seaweed
